Dodgers recall INF DeWitt from Triple-A (AP)
The slumping Los Angeles Dodgers recalled infielder Blake DeWitt from Triple-A Las Vegas on Wednesday, making room on their 25-man roster by designating infielder Pablo Ozuna for assignment. DeWitt was optioned to Las Vegas on July 26, when the Dodgers acquired infielder Casey Blake from the Cleveland Indians.

Red Sox lose Drew to DL; Beckett to start Friday
J.D. Drew has been placed on the 15-day disabled list with a lower back strain, leaving the Red Sox without their All-Star right fielder as they head into a tight pennant race.
